Valves are essential components across industries such as oil and gas, power generation, water treatment and chemical processing. They regulate and/or isolate fluid flow, ensuring safe and efficient system operation. To guarantee reliability and performance, valves must conform to rigorous standards developed by organizations like the American Petroleum Institute (API), the American Society of Mechanical Engineers (ASME), the Manufacturers Standardization Society (MSS) and the International Organization for Standardization (ISO).
